I have a 03 accord that has an ecm problem and needs to be replaced I need to know if you replace it with a used ecm if it needs to be reprogrammed or what . they keep telling me that it needs to be programed for my key and immobilizer. But that is a part to itself and if so what scanner can do this?

Based on quick review of 03-06 shop manual, the ECM/PCM must be reprogrammed to recognize the immoblizer system (keys). This requires a Honda Diagnostic System (HDS) or equivalent clone. Honda service center and most key replacement services can perform this service.
